Why I Started This Blog

Technology fills every nook and cranny of our lives, whether we want it to or not. As technological advancements vastly outpace the general public’s knowledge, how can we make sure that it works for us, and not the other way around?

As the tech-geek in my circle, friends and family would come to me with questions like “is my phone listening to me?”, “what is a cookie”, and “how does artificial intelligence actually work?”. I didn’t always have the answers, but I loved researching and finding out.

In my research, I realised that it can be hard to find answers that aren’t filled with jargon and have real, relatable examples. I started to wonder, with tech no longer just for the technical-minded, how can we make sure that not only is it accessible to all, but that it’s fair? Thus, the EBIT blog was born.
